Acoustic glass

Acoustic glass can be put in to improve the acoustics within your home. It will block out any noise that comes into your home.

Acoustic glass that is of the highest quality can cut down to 40 dB of sound. To get the best results, you will be required to choose the appropriate thickness. You can also opt for a different kind of glass, such as laminated glass.

Noise pollution is a major problem throughout the world. It can have a negative impact on your health. It can disrupt your sleep, and can even affect your memory. Noise can cause high blood pressure and heart problems in certain people.

Acoustic glass is the ideal method of achieving noise reduction. It can be costly. In fact, it's not uncommon for Acoustic glass to be much more expensive than double-glazed windows.

You can enhance the acoustic effect by making it more obvious by filling up the space between the glass panes by using dense inert gases. This will raise the cost but will also add the sound absorption.

The size of the air space plays a significant role in the sound-acoustic effect. A larger air space is usually more efficient in the reduction of noise.

Acoustic glass is typically two-paned. You can also purchase single-pane acoustic glasses.

Acoustic glass thicknesses can vary from 4 mm to 6 inches. There are four types of acoustic glasses. Each one has a u-value that is 1.1 W/m2.

For the best results, acoustic glass should be put in areas where you're trying to block out sounds. If you live near a bustling railway line or street, you might want to think about a more robust glass.

Privacy glass

Privacy glass is a particular kind of glass that offers additional privacy in vehicles. It is also referred to by the names obscure glass and textured glass.

Glass that is patterned or frosty can block the view from both sides. However, it is not able to guarantee complete privacy.

The sun emits ultraviolet rays that can cause skin cancer. These rays can also cause material quality to diminish. Utilizing a tinted window can reduce the effects. You can also choose an frosted glass window which allows light to pass through, but does not allow you to view outside.

Laminate glass is yet another kind of glass. This kind of glass holds together even when it breaks. It is typically made from polyvinyl butyral. Laminated glass is a good option for security but it can also be used for sound absorption.

Similarly, textured glass is transparent and has a pattern imprinted into its surface. Textured glass does not block the view, but it can make the view more interesting.

The same process is employed to create a glass that is frosted. The effect of frosted is achieved by the application of an acid etching or sandblasting procedure to a transparent sheet of glass.

Another kind of textured glass is called satin glass. It is chemically treated to give it a satin look. Satin glass can be used to give your home a more ethnic look.

Window films are also available that give a frosted appearance without the hassle and expense of frosty glass. Nonetheless, these are not as efficient as window tinting.

You may want to think about glasses that are laminated or sandblasted for maximum privacy. It is important to remember that these windows do not provide the same protection from the sun's UV rays like window tinting.

Self-cleaning glass

Self-cleaning glass is an excellent method to cut down on the amount of time and money spent cleaning your windows. It's especially beneficial for conservatories as well as other difficult-to-access areas.

The self-cleaning glass technology uses natural forces to assist you in saving time and effort while also making your windows look better. There are a variety of self-cleaning glass which is why it's worthwhile to do some research prior to you purchase.

A special coating is sprayed on the glass. The coating is thin enough to be barely visible to the naked eye, but it does have an impact on how water behaves. It can be used to disintegrate organic dirt but not as effectively for grime that is more heavy.

Rainwater streaks are prevented by the glass coating. Glass is easier to clean because drops of water are spread in thin layers across it.

Self-cleaning glass can be put in virtually any exterior surface including skylights. You will need to make sure you use pure water on the glazing to keep it looking good.

A high quality self-cleaning glass can be used for a long time. The coating needs to be reapplied every five to seven years.

Some businesses offer a 10-year guarantee on their products. Pilkington Activ(tm) and Cardinal Neat(r) Glass are two brands that are available. Be sure to request a free inspection before making a final decision.

Self-cleaning glass could be an investment worth it. However, not all circumstances are suitable for this kind of product.

It's not as simple as it seems. To keep your windows clean and free of harmful substances, you will need to clean them frequently. For instance bird droppings, bird droppings and other heavy dirt should be dealt with by professionals.

Repair costs

If you've got a damaged triple or double pane windows, you should know that fixing it is typically cheaper than replacing it. Triple or double pane windows are sealed to keep heat out and cold out. However, they could fail for a variety of reasons.

The cost of a broken window repair can vary based on the size, type of glass, and the severity of damage. You may also need to replace parts, which could increase the price. A window repair that has been damaged usually cost around $200. Larger windows as well as arched or curled panes could be more costly to replace.

Depending on where you live, double-pane replacement windows can cost between $400 and $600. This kind of window requires more labor and special tools than a single pane. It is best for older bow or bay windows that need to be repaired.

Most glaziers charge between $100 and $150 for a call-out fee. They also charge between $35 and $75 per hour after they've arrived at your home. They usually provide estimates at no cost. Make sure you ask questions and request three quotes.

A Glazier will replace the glass and also clean the inside of the panes. Depending on the upvc windows glass replacement you have the process could take up to an hour.

When choosing a glazier, look for a company that has a good reputation. There are many sources online to help pick a reputable company.
